Question
Discuss the characteristics of working capital.

Answer
Characteristics of working capital:
Short term capital: Working capital is a short term capital.
Investment in current assets: Working capital $($Gross$)$ is used in current assets such as bill receivables, debtors, short term marketable securities, bank balance, cash, etc.
Liquidity: Liquidity is the basic feature of working capital. All the current assets in which working capital is employed are converted into cash easily.
Less risk: Working capital gets circulated for short term and it is easily convertible cash $($i.e. it has high liquidity$).$ Hence, there is less risk in working capital.
Changing form: The form of working capital keeps on changing constantly. For example, raw material is converted into semi-finished goods and finally into finished goods. Finished goods are converted into debtors if they get sold on credit, and into cash, if sold on cash.
To pay day-to-day expenses: Working capital is needed constantly to pay day-to-day expenses.
No depreciation: Since the form of working capital keeps on changing, its depreciation is not calculated.
Requirement according to type and form of business: Need of working capital depends upon the form and type of business. Thus its ratio is different in each business.
